Planted in Purpose is a Scripture-centered podcast rooted in Psalm 1:3  that we would be like trees planted by the rivers of water, bearing fruit in our season and grounded in Ephesians 2:10, which reminds us that we are God’s handiwork, created in Christ Jesus for good works prepared in advance for us to walk in.This podcast exists to remind women of faith that they are not accidental, delayed, or overlooked but intentionally formed, positioned, and called by God for Kingdom purpose.Hosted by Sheri Neely, Planted in Purpose is a space for women who desire deeper intimacy with God, spiritual clarity, and the confidence to walk in obedience. Through biblical teaching, testimony, prayer, and conversations with women of faith, Sheri explores what it truly means to be planted by God formed in hidden seasons, protected through spiritual warfare, and positioned for divine assignment.Each episode equips women to mature spiritually, sharpen their discernment, and step fully into their identity as daughters entrusted with Kingdom influence.This podcast is for the woman who senses God calling her deeper but needs clarity for her next step. It is also for the woman who has been faithful in obedience and simply needs renewed strength to keep going.Here, you will find: • Encouragement anchored in Scripture • Prayer and declarations • Conversations with women walking boldly in faith • Leadership and spiritual development for womenIf you are ready to grow steadily, hear God clearly, and walk confidently in your assignment, you are in the right place.Whether you are rebuilding, refining, or stepping into a new season, this podcast will help you grow roots that run deep and bear fruit that lasts.Stay planted. Grow in purpose.

Episode 11 | The Fear of the Lord Part 2: Learning to Draw Near to God

“Reverence is recognizing who God is—and responding accordingly.”  Have you ever felt like your relationship with God was built more on pressure than peace? More on performance than presence? In Part 2 of our Fear of the Lord series, Sheri Neely invites you into a deeper understanding of what it truly means to reverence God—not with terror, shame, or fear of punishment, but with awe, surrender, intimacy, and love. This episode moves beyond simply understanding God’s requirements and into the transformation of the heart. Through powerful teaching, personal reflection, Psalm 34, and intentional prayer, Sheri shares how the fear of the Lord is not meant to push us away from God—it is meant to draw us closer to Him. You will discover that reverence is not about striving to be “good enough.” It is about learning to live aware of the presence, holiness, goodness, and love of God. In this episode, we explore: From Terror to Holy Awe Understanding the difference between fear rooted in punishment and the worshipful reverence of a loving Father. Psalm 34 & The Invitation to the Table What it means to “taste and see that the Lord is good” and how God sustains us through the Bread of Life, Living Water, and New Wine. The Hebrew Meaning of Reverence A deeper look at the Hebrew word Yirah and how reverence begins with awareness of who God truly is. The 5 Pillars of a Reverent Heart How to cultivate: *  Spiritual Sensitivity  *  Humble Dependency  *  Worshipful Awe  *  Sacred Gratitude  *  Yielded Loyalty  Intentional Prayer & Ministry Time Stay until the end for a special time of prayer, including: *  a Fear of the Lord prayer  *  a forgiveness and restoration prayer  *  a salvation invitation and prayer  This episode is for the woman who is weary, spiritually hungry, rebuilding, healing, growing, or longing to draw closer to God in a real and personal way. Episode 10 | The Fear of the Lord: What God Really Requires

“The fear of the Lord is not information. It is formation.”  As children, many of us were taught that "fearing God" meant being afraid of Him—living in constant worry of punishment or failure. But as we grow in our Kingdom walk, we realize that the fear of the Lord isn't about being scared; it’s about being anchored. In this milestone 10th episode, Sheri Neely dives deep into the Book of Deuteronomy to uncover what God truly requires of us. Whether you are a mother, an entrepreneur, or a leader, this teaching will shift your perspective from performance-based religion to posture-based relationship. In this episode, we explore: * The Difference Between Terror and Reverence: Why the fear of the Lord is something we must learn and cultivate, not just feel. * Heart Posture Over Performance: Understanding why God is more moved by your "why" than your "what." * The 5 Pillars of Reverence: How the fear of the Lord stabilizes you in transition, protects your identity, shapes your choices, grounds your leadership, and builds your legacy. * The 10:12 Requirement: A breakdown of the four things God asks of every believer: Fear Him, Walk with Him, Love Him, and Serve Him. What you fear, you will ultimately serve. If you’re ready to stop serving the fear of people, the fear of lack, or the fear of failure, this episode will show you how to realign your life under the only reverence that sets you free. Your Kingdom Assignment: Stay tuned until the end for a practical 5-step challenge to help you walk out this reverence in your daily life. Episode 9: Thankful | Living a LIfe of Gratitude

There is a difference between saying “thank you” and living a life of gratitude. In this episode of Planted in Purpose: A Kingdom Building Podcast, Sheri D. Neely leads a powerful and timely conversation on what it truly means to cultivate a heart of gratitude, not as a reaction to circumstances, but as a consistent posture before God. Building on the foundation of forgiveness from the previous episode, this message invites you into the next level of spiritual alignment: replacing what has been released with intentional thanksgiving. Through Scripture, thoughtful word study, and personal reflection, Sheri unpacks how gratitude: * anchors your relationship with God  * transforms your prayer life from routine to reverent  * shifts your perspective in every season  * strengthens your faith through testimony  * and extends beyond God into how you honor others  This episode speaks directly to the woman who carries much—the mother, the wife, the leader, the caregiver, the entrepreneur—the one who shows up for everyone else, yet rarely pauses to sit in God’s presence with intentional gratitude. With clarity and conviction, you’ll be challenged to move beyond quick acknowledgments and into a deeper, more meaningful expression of thanksgiving—one that includes your worship, your words, and your witness. Because gratitude is not just something you say…  it is how you approach God. Episode 8: Forgiven | Releasing What Hurt You and Walking in Freedom

In this powerful and deeply personal episode of Planted in Purpose, we walk through the truth about forgiveness—not just as a concept, but as a command, a process, and a pathway to freedom. Forgiveness is not always easy, especially when the hurt runs deep. Whether it stems from family, friendships, marriage, the workplace, business, or even experiences within the church, many of us carry things we were never meant to hold onto. Over time, that weight can quietly shape our thoughts, our relationships, and even our spiritual walk. But Scripture calls us higher. In this episode, we explore what the Bible truly says about forgiveness, why we are called to forgive, what unforgiveness does to the soul, and how releasing others is directly connected to our own healing and freedom in Christ. Through foundational scriptures, spiritual insight, and personal reflection, you’ll be guided through:  • What forgiveness is, and what it is not  • Why forgiveness is not optional for believers  • The spiritual and emotional impact of unforgiveness  • How forgiveness affects your relationship with God  • The difference between forgiveness and reconciliation  • How to move forward with wisdom and the leading of the Holy Spirit This episode also includes a guided reflection moment and a powerful prayer for forgiveness and healing, as well as an invitation for those who desire to begin or renew their relationship with Christ. If you’ve been carrying hurt—whether visible or buried—this is your moment to release it. You don’t have to hold onto what God is calling you to let go of.  Forgiveness is not about excusing what happened… It’s about choosing freedom over bondage. Episode 7: Loved | Understanding the Depth of God’s Love featuring Min. Queen Jackson

What does it truly mean to be loved by God? In this powerful and heartfelt episode of Planted in Purpose, we explore the depth, truth, and transforming power of God’s love...how it keeps us, covers us, and carries us through every season of life. So many of us have wrestled with the idea that we must earn love, prove ourselves, or get everything right before we are fully accepted. But God’s love doesn’t work that way. It is not earned. It is not conditional. It is freely given. In this episode, we are reminded that: * God’s love is constant—even when we are not * God’s love covers us in our weakest moments * God’s love calls us higher, not through pressure, but through grace Joining me in this conversation is Minister Queen Jackson, a woman of wisdom, discernment, and a deep understanding of God’s love. She serves as the Associate Pastor of Fruit of Faith Church, where her husband, Pastor Anthony Jackson, is the Lead Pastor and has faithfully served in ministry for over 24 years. She also leads The Whole Woman Ministry, where she pours into women through Bible study, conferences, and gatherings focused on healing, growth, and wholeness. I’ve personally been blessed to be part of her Bible studies and events, and to experience the impact of her ministry firsthand. This is more than a conversation. This is an invitation to experience God’s love in a deeper, more personal way.
